Output ebd23f88bdd509b34fca88e59167c792ac9223433258cfffca851773f2a40579:0

value
18649551
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fd68e140e800f44d3f0e069d04b40415f347560 OP_EQUALVERIFY OP_CHECKSIG
address
1MQYiKb6nn2vg6ErhsVYuzMzm7swsHmPYh
transaction
ebd23f88bdd509b34fca88e59167c792ac9223433258cfffca851773f2a40579
confirmations
512213
spent
true